William P. Farley is the pastor of Grace Christian Fellowship in Spokane, Washington. He's the author of Gospel-Powered Parenting: How the Gospel Shapes and Transforms Parenting.
Books on "right" or "correct" parenting abound. The problem is, even in the Christian realm, how many books on parenting are truly gospel centered?
Originally designed to be a book on fatherhood, William eventually ended up with a book that expresses things that he feels no one else was saying on the issue of parenting. Specifically, he wanted to communicate that Christian parents can't simply protect their children from worldly influences and think they've done their job. They need to steer their children to the new birth as described in the gospel as this will help children themselves to overcome the world.
Additional specifics of gospel powered parenting that were discussed include: What is Godward vs. childward parenting; the first principle of parenting; the foundation of proper discipline, as well as other helpful insights.
